HF RFID系统中整流器设计与分析
Rectifier Design and Analysis in HF RFID System
【摘要】 设计了几种基于CMOS工艺的高频RFID整流器,包括:桥式整流器,栅压交叉连接桥式整流器,NMOS-PMOS栅压交叉连接桥式整流器.分析了NMOS栅压交叉连接桥式整流器和PMOS栅压交叉连接桥式整流器的结构和特点.所设计的这两种电路具有负载驱动能力强,漏电流低,电路能量转换效率高等特性,并且随着输入功率的变化有着很好的电路稳定性.另外对一种改进型NMOS-PMOS栅压交叉连接桥式整流器电路进行了讨论,在一定的输入功率下这种电路具有很高的能量转换效率.给出了几种电路的仿真结果,并对仿真数据进行了比较.
【Abstract】 Several CMOS-based high frequency RFID rectifiers are presented,including bridge rectifier,gate cross-connected bridge rectifier,NMOS-PMOS gate cross-connected bridge rectifier.Structure and characteristics of NMOS gate cross-connect bridge rectifier and PMOS gate cross-connect bridge rectifier are analysed.Both circuits are designed with a load driving capability,low leakage current,high efficiency energy conversion circuit characteristics.And with the change of the input power circuit has a good stability.A kind of improved NMOS-PMOS gate cross-connected bridge rectifier circuitis.It has an excellent PCEat a certain input voltage level.The results of several circuit simulations are given,and simulation data are compared.
